Housing definition

Housing means residential housing including dwellings and other forms of residential accommodation;
Housing means housing as defined in Iowa Code section 16.1(16)“a.”
Housing means residential accommodation and facilities, common areas and services used directly with the residential accommodation. Housing does not include commercial or institutional premises, social or recreational services, and services or facilities related to mental or physical health care, education, corrections, food services, social support or public recreation;

More Definitions of Housing

Housing means residential accommodation, and facilities, common areas and services used directly with the residential accommodation. Housing does not include commercial or institutional premises, social or recreational services, and services or facilities related to mental or physical health care, education, corrections, food services, social support or public recreation;
Housing means new or rehabilitated structures with 8 or more residential units in 1 or more of the structures for occupancy and use by elderly or disabled persons, including essential contiguous land and related facilities as well as all personal property of the corporation, association, or limited dividend housing corporation used in connection with the facilities.
Housing means publicly owned housing, individual or multifamily.
Housing means single family and multifamily dwellings, and facilities incidental or appurtenant to the dwellings, and includes group homes of fifteen beds or less licensed as health care facilities or child foster care facilities and modular or mobile homes which are permanently affixed to a foundation and are assessed as realty.
Housing means housing as defined in Iowa Code section 16.1(14).

Housing means any improved property, or any portion thereof, including a mobile home as defined in s.101.91 (10), manufactured home, as defined in s. 101.91 (2), or condominium, that is used or occupied, or is intended, arranged or designed to be used or occupied, as a home or residence. “Housing” includes any vacant land that is offered for sale or rent for the construction or location thereon of any building, structure or portion thereof that is used or occupied, or is intended, arranged or designed to be used or occupied, as a home or residence.
